Transaction

3295e4e3ffd34e9d864a3a4b49d1e336386f547caeeb617997232197f287703e

Summary

In Block188226
TimeThu, 18 May 2023 07:03:15 UTC
Total Input571.73209635 Nebula
Total Output626.73209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
764712 Confirmations626.73209635 Nebula
Raw Transaction